[0022] A method for hydroponic cultivation of peach seedlings, specifically comprising the following steps:

[0023] 1. Select the seeds of the wild peach in the same year as the test material. Wash off the surface impurities of peach seeds with clean water, soak for 2-3 days to make the seeds fully absorb water; mix the seeds and wet sand at a ratio of 1:5, stack them in a plastic box, keep a certain humidity, and carry out low-temperature stratification in a 4°C refrigerator. Abstract

The invention relates to a hydroponic method for peach seedlings. The hydroponic method comprises the following steps that the peach seedlings are cultured by the hydroponic method, the oxygen introduction time is set to be 30min/h in the culture period, a 1/4-fold Hoagland nutrient solution is adopted as the hydroponic nutrient solution, 2500lx illumination intensity and constant temperature of 25 +/-1 DEG C are adopted, and the illumination time is 16h/d. According to the hydroponic method for the peach seedlings, a hydroponic system is established in peaches for the first time, the growth environment of the peach seedlings can be accurately regulated and controlled, and the influence of the external environment on growth of the peach seedlings is explored by clearly and visually observing the root system form and the plant phenotype. The hydroponic method for the peach seedlings is not limited by the field environment, annual supply can be achieved, the research period is shortened,a convenient technical means is provided for scientific research, and the hydroponic method for the peach seedlings has important significance in research of plants (especially root systems) with thepeach seedlings as research objects and the external environment.

technical field [0001] The invention relates to the field of peach cultivation methods, in particular to a hydroponic method for peach seedlings. Background technique [0002] For a long time, peach trees have been planted and scientifically studied by soil cultivation. Due to being in an open-air environment, there are many uncontrollable factors, and the plants are easily affected by the soil environment, resulting in the breeding of diseases and insect pests and uneven nutrient absorption, etc.; and soil cultivation is time-consuming and labor-intensive, and the input cost is high (Rutto and Mizutani 2006, Bent et al 2009). In addition, as a perennial plant, the peach tree has a wide distribution of root systems. Excavating from the soil can easily destroy the integrity of the root system, and it is difficult to clean, which makes it very difficult to observe the root system (Dunying 2011).
